Key Features of the Disposable Endocutter Stapler II for Surgical Efficiency
Surgical efficiency is not just about speed; it is about seamless workflow and reliable outcomes. The Jingpin Disposable Endocutter Stapler II is engineered with features that directly address this. Its design facilitates one-handed operation, freeing the surgeon's other hand to manipulate tissue, which is invaluable in both open and endoscopic settings. For procedures in confined spaces, such as thoracic or pelvic surgeries, the device’s larger joint head angle with adaptive stepless adjustment allows for superior maneuverability. A good laparoscopic stapler supplier understands the challenges of working with varied tissue thicknesses. This stapler’s new negative angle design increases jaw pressure, ensuring effective staple formation even in dense or thick tissues. Furthermore, the integrated gecko claw design minimizes tissue overflow during firing, providing a clean and secure staple line. The innovative nail slot and equidistant three-point gap control work together to consistently produce clinical 'B' shaped staples. This level of consistency reduces the risk of malformed staples and improves the integrity of the anastomosis or tissue closure, ultimately saving time and improving patient safety. These thoughtful design elements demonstrate a deep understanding of the surgical process and a commitment to advancing procedural outcomes.
Comparing Medical Stapler Designs for Open and Endoscopic Procedures
Surgical staplers must meet different demands in traditional open surgeries compared to minimally invasive endoscopic procedures. Open surgery often allows for direct access and manual manipulation, but still benefits from devices that are ergonomic and efficient. In contrast, endoscopic surgery relies on long, slender instruments inserted through small incisions, demanding exceptional precision and remote control. Leading medical devices manufacturers strive to create instruments that can perform well in both arenas. The Jingpin Disposable Endocutter Stapler II exemplifies this versatility. While its longer shafts, available in 190mm, 250mm, and 350mm lengths, are ideal for reaching deep into the abdominal or thoracic cavity during laparoscopic procedures, its ergonomic handle and one-handed firing mechanism are equally advantageous in an open setting. The articulating head is crucial for endoscopy, allowing surgeons to approach tissue from optimal angles without creating larger incisions. For open procedures, this same articulation provides flexibility in complex anatomical regions. By offering a single, reliable platform that adapts to different surgical approaches, such a device helps hospitals standardize their equipment, simplify training for surgical teams, and ensure consistent performance regardless of the procedural context, improving overall workflow.
How Laparoscopic Staplers Improve Precision in Gastrointestinal Surgery
Gastrointestinal surgery, which includes procedures on the stomach, intestines, and other digestive organs, demands a high degree of precision to ensure secure closures and prevent leaks. The advent of advanced laparoscopic staplers has been instrumental in elevating the standard of care in this field. A reputable laparoscopic stapler supplier provides tools that allow surgeons to perform complex anastomoses with greater accuracy than ever before. The Jingpin Disposable Endocutter Stapler II, for instance, contributes significantly to this precision. Its ability to articulate allows surgeons to position the stapler jaws accurately around the target tissue, even in deep or awkward locations within the abdominal cavity. The gecko claw design is particularly useful here, as it gently grips the tissue and prevents slippage during firing, ensuring the staple line is placed exactly where intended. This is critical for creating a durable and leak-proof seal. The device’s consistent formation of 'B' shaped staples, ensured by the unique nail slot and gap control, provides uniform tissue compression, which promotes better healing. For medical devices manufacturers, the goal is to minimize tissue trauma and improve patient recovery, and these features directly support that objective by creating reliable, clean transections and closures.
